Sharp intros AQUOS LE700 LED series
Sharp has announced its latest AQUOS LCD HDTVs for the United States--the 52-inch LC-52LE700UN, the 46-inch LC-46LE700UN, the 40-inch LC-40E700UN and the 32-inch LC-32LE700UN. Strangely, Sharp opted out of using local-dimming LEDs for these models. The key features of the LE700 AQUOS LED series include:
- 10-bit 1080p X-Gen LCD panel
- UltraBrilliant LED backlighting
- 2, 000, 000:1 dynamic contrast ratio
- dejudder on the 46- and 52-inch models
- 120 Hz frame rate
- 4 millisecond response time
- 176 degree viewing angle
- AQUOS Net internet connectivity
- 4 x HDMI v1.3 with Deep Color
- 2 x component inputs
- 1 x RS232C
- 1 x USB
- AQUOS Link (one remote HDMI synchronization)
- Energy Star 3.0 certified
The four LE700 AQUOS models are available this month, from largest to smallest priced at $2799.99, $2199.99, $1699.99 and $1099.99, respectively.
